Galacean Effects:从零开始掌握现代Web动画特效的终极指南
2026/6/17 17:25:26 网站建设 项目流程

Galacean Effects:从零开始掌握现代Web动画特效的终极指南

【免费下载链接】effects-runtimeIt can load and render cool animation effects项目地址: https://gitcode.com/gh_mirrors/ef/effects-runtime

在当今数字化时代,动画特效已成为提升用户体验的关键要素。Galacean Effects作为一款开源的现代Web动画特效库,为开发者提供了简单高效的方式来创建专业的视觉动画效果,让每个人都能轻松制作出令人惊艳的动态体验。

🎯 为什么选择Galacean Effects?

简单易用的特性让Galacean Effects脱颖而出。不同于传统的复杂动画制作流程,这个库采用直观的API设计,即使是Web开发新手也能快速上手。

核心优势亮点

  • 🚀零基础入门:无需专业设计背景,轻松创建动画
  • 💫丰富效果库:内置多种预设动画,满足不同场景需求
  • 🔧模块化架构:按需加载功能,优化项目性能
  • 📱跨平台兼容:支持多种设备和浏览器环境

🌟 动画效果展示与实际应用

![Galacean Effects动画特效展示](https://raw.gitcode.com/gh_mirrors/ef/effects-runtime/raw/c561272292ae73ea81c8f8d82ae2cc755299c0db/web-packages/demo/public/assets/find-flower/downgrade/春花 .png?utm_source=gitcode_repo_files)

Galacean Effects能够实现的动画效果范围广泛,从简单的按钮悬停效果到复杂的粒子系统动画,都能轻松应对。

📚 快速上手:三步开启动画之旅

第一步:环境准备与项目搭建

开始使用Galacean Effects的第一步是配置开发环境。通过简单的命令即可完成项目搭建:

git clone https://gitcode.com/gh_mirrors/ef/effects-runtime cd effects-runtime pnpm install

第二步:核心概念理解

掌握几个关键概念就能快速制作动画:

  • 场景(Scene):动画的舞台,管理所有动画元素
  • 组件(Component):可复用的动画单元
  • 播放器(Player):控制动画的播放状态

第三步:第一个动画制作

通过简单的配置就能创建基础动画效果。库内置了丰富的预设模板,让初学者也能快速产出专业级动画。

🔧 核心功能模块详解

Galacean Effects的强大之处在于其完善的模块化设计:

动画系统模块

  • 官方文档:docs/developing.md
  • 核心源码:packages/effects-core/src/

渲染引擎模块

  • WebGL渲染:packages/effects-webgl/src/
  • Three.js集成:packages/effects-threejs/src/

💡 实用技巧与最佳实践

性能优化建议

为了确保动画在各种设备上流畅运行,建议关注以下几点:

  • 合理控制动画元素数量
  • 优化图片资源大小
  • 使用合适的帧率设置

开发效率提升

利用现有的资源快速起步:

  • 参考示例代码:web-packages/demo/src/
  • 学习插件开发:plugin-packages/

🚀 进阶应用场景

Galacean Effects不仅适用于基础动画制作,还能胜任复杂的应用场景:

营销活动动画: 创建吸引眼球的促销动画,提升用户参与度

产品展示特效: 为产品介绍添加动态元素,增强视觉冲击力

数据可视化: 将枯燥的数据转化为生动的动画图表

📈 持续学习与资源获取

想要深入掌握Galacean Effects?项目提供了丰富的学习资源:

  • 详细开发文档
  • 多种示例演示
  • 社区支持与讨论

✨ 总结与展望

Galacean Effects为Web动画开发带来了革命性的改变。通过这个强大的工具,开发者可以:

  • 快速实现专业级动画效果
  • 降低开发门槛和学习成本
  • 提升产品的视觉体验质量

无论你是刚接触Web开发的新手,还是寻求更高效动画解决方案的专业开发者,Galacean Effects都能为你提供理想的动画制作体验。开始你的动画创作之旅,让创意在屏幕上生动绽放!

【免费下载链接】effects-runtimeIt can load and render cool animation effects项目地址: https://gitcode.com/gh_mirrors/ef/effects-runtime

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询